The objective of this study is to develop a desiccant system using natural mesoporous material, Wakkanai siliceous shale. A honeycombed desiccant rotor containing this shale's powder and chlorides was made and evaluated. The dehumidification ability was 7〜15% higher than that of the silica-gel rotor. Amount of dehumidification gave 3.0〜5.6 g/kg_<DA> at the range of 0.5〜10 rpm. The rate of energy reduction to remove the outdoor air-conditioning load was estimated to be 50% by combination this rotor and a sensible heat exchanger. In addition, the rotor could dehumidify stably in the continuous test for a week.
